 def search(self, *terms):
     """Don't use this. This is painfully slow."""
     desc_re = re.compile(r"%DESC%\n.*{0}.*$".format(".*".join(terms)),
                          re.IGNORECASE | re.MULTILINE)
     for db in ALPM_DB_PATH.join("sync").glob("*.db"):
         if db.name[:-3] not in self.enabled_repositories:
             continue
         seen = []
         try:
             tar = tarfile.open(db, "r")
         except tarfile.ReadError:
             log.error("could not open db file: {0}".format(db))
             continue
         for member in tar.getmembers():
             member_path = path(member.name)
             if member_path.name != "desc":
                 continue
             package = member_path.parent
             if package.name in seen:
                 continue
             desc = tar.extractfile(member).read()
             if (len(terms) == 1 and
                 re.match(terms[0], package.name, re.IGNORECASE)):
                 seen.append(package.name)
             else:
                 if re.search(desc_re, desc):
                     seen.append(package.name)
                 else:
                     continue
             metadata = self.parse_desc(desc)
             yield ALPMPackage(metadata=metadata)
